ShellyCrash 05-03-2011 09:21 PM

Certain alcohols seem to have slightly different effect, but it usually applies to the type of booze not really the brand- ie getting drunk off tequila feels a little different vs getting drunk from whiskey vs drinking something like absinthe.

I feel that with top shelf you're really paying for the flavor profile and consistency (and occasionally just the bs branding). If you care about taste and how it goes down some top shelfs are totally worth the money- like for example while some may argue over if you can pick out kettle one vs gray goose nearly anyone can tell them apart from a no name bargain bottle- but if you're just drinking to get drunk all that really matters is the proof.
